Correction to Written Statement HCWS1455

Written ministerial statementMade by Steve ReedSecret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local GovernmentMinistry of Housing, Communities and Local GovernmentHCWS1485

On 25 March I made a written statement on Local Government Reorganisation. There was a minor error in the statement. In outlining the new councils to be created in Suffolk, it said:

“Central and Eastern Suffolk Council (current local government areas of West Suffolk, 21 parishes from Mid Suffolk, and Babergh (less 31 parishes)).Western Suffolk Council (current local government areas of Mid Suffolk (less 29 parishes), and East Suffolk (less 25 parishes).”It should have said:

“Western Suffolk Council (current local government areas of West Suffolk, 21 parishes from Mid Suffolk, and Babergh (less 31 parishes)).Central and Eastern Suffolk Council (current local government areas of Mid Suffolk (less 29 parishes), and East Suffolk (less 25 parishes).”
